Reporter the Santa Cruz Sheriffs Office are mourning the loss of 38yearold Sergeant Damon gutzwiller. Shesh i have jim hart said at 1 30 saturday afternoon, a person reported seeing a van with guns and bombmaking devices. While Sergeant Gutzwiller and another deputy began investigating the van, parked off waldenberg avenue in ben lomond, they were attacked. As deputies began investigating they were ambushed with gunfire. And multiple improvised explosives. Officer down, lz set up by highlands park, officer down at 1430. Reporter Sergeant Gutzwiller was shot, and taken to the hospital, were he died. Another deputy was either shot or struck by shrapnel from the bomb. Sources tell our dan noyes investigators found many ieds at the home. Noyes reports one theory is deputies interrupted Something Big about to happen. It prompted the fbi to take over the case. Carrillo reshared a post last week making comments about equality for all races not just white people. Carrillo has two children and a late wife who was in the air force, died in an off base hotel in carolina in 2018. Authorities say her death was not suspicious. Lets get to other developing news, following several fastmoving fires made worse by the strong winds in the bay area this weekend. Several broke out yesterday including the quail fire burning outside of the town of winters along with the willow fire in concord and gulch fire south of petaluma. The quail fire burned 1,200 acres at last check. Its 5 contained. We know at least 100 structures are threatened and evacuations have been under way. Overnight the San FranciscoFire Department is sending 22 firefighters and fire trucks to help out this morning. The willow fire in concord is fully contained at 137 acres are near east oliviera road and willow pass road. It at one point blocked access to highway 4. Firefighters are keeping a close eye on hot spots in Sonoma County, started along stage gulch road. Big part of this is the winds weve been talking about all weekend. Three bay area counties continue to ease pandemic restrictions and lets break it down for you. Here is what is now allowed in the north bay. In napa county, wineries can open indoor tasting rooms with social distancing. Reservations are encouraged to avoid overlaps. Servers must offer clean glasses every time they try a different wine. Bars may also reopen and in Sonoma County many businesses including hair salons can reopen. We have a look at what that will look like in our next half hour. Restaurants can serve diners indoors again, tables spaced six feet apart. People can also attend indoor religious services. The 83yearold Golden Gate Bridge has been under a retrofitting project to protect it from high winds. The handrails on the west side has been replaced with the vertical slats allow more air to flow through. During high wind days the bridge emits whistling sounds that can be heard for miles.
